#e52151 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e52151 is composed of 89.8% red, 12.9%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 85.6% magenta, 64.6%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 345.3 degrees, a saturation of 79% and a lightness of 51.4%. #e52151 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ff42a2 with #cb0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3366.

Shades and Tints of #e52151

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060102 is the darkest color, while #fef4f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e52151

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#868082 is the less saturated color, while #f80e47 is the most saturated one.
